Ex Commodore Frank Lemass – RTE Film 1963
In the early 1960s plans were mooted which might have involved the National Yacht Club relocating from its current location. The Commodore, Frank Lemass spoke to RTE News about the issue and this wonderful film has now been made available by the RTE Archive...

Invitation to the 2018 Volvo Irish Sailing Awards
We have three young members of the National nominated for Awards. Hugh OâConnor is nominated for the Volvo Irish Sailor of the Year, and both Nell Staunton and Rian Geraghty-McDonnell are nominated for the Volvo Irish Sailing Youth Sailor of the Year â if any of our memberswould like to go along and cheer them all on !
